Last year was China’s hottest on record, weather agency says

May Be Interested In:Evertop DIY PC will give you hundreds of hours of DOS fun on a single charge




China’s average national temperature for 2024 was 1.03 degrees higher than average, making it “the warmest year since the start of full records in 1961”, China Meteorological Administration said Wednesday night. The world’s largest greenhouse gas emitter, China also experienced devastating floods last year.
